[Thus, you have John borrowing a page from Mr. Nixon’s old playbook -
blame the elite East Coast media for being on Barack’s side. How is the
same media that spent weeks generating Rev. Wright stories about Barack
on his side, you wonder? Well, they are apparently spending too much
time focusing on John’s lies, and not enough on Barack’s. In a rather
funny article, Ben Smith at Politico tells us about a conference call
from John’s people yesterday in which they used several examples of the
media’s unfair coverage. However, in almost every instance they
presented, they stretched the truth.

The sad thing is, while
John’s people are using tricks from the same old playbook that has
worked for them since 1968, the nation is realizing that we are facing
the greatest threat to our way of life since Hoover was in office.
While Barack addresses the issues, John plays politics. Hell, even
George Will, not a member of what anyone would call the liberal elite,
can see that. He writes, “Under the pressure of the financial crisis,
one presidential candidate is behaving like a flustered rookie playing
in a league too high. It is not Barack Obama.” Ouch, John. No wonder
you’re upset.]
